Following the novel’s basic arc: Constance Reid marries aristocrat Clifford Chatterley, who returns from the war paralyzed from the waist down. In their bleak, mechanized home of Wragby Hall, Connie finds herself emotionally and sexually starved. Clifford encourages her to take a lover for an heir, but his cold, intellectual possessiveness drives her toward Oliver Mellors, the gamekeeper. Their affair, conducted in the woods and his cottage, becomes a transformative sexual and spiritual awakening. When Connie becomes pregnant, she must choose between security with Clifford or scandal with Mellors.
